The Mexican Association of Biomass and Biogas (AMBB®) is a non-governmental organization developing new techniques and strategies to rethink the final disposal of waste from some diverse human activities in Mexico, in particular solid and liquid organic waste, both urban and agro-industrial.
Background on the creation of the AMBB®
In the context of Global Warming, as well as in the Environmental crisis that the world has been facing for the last years, and taking into account the assumption that we all must participate in being part of the solution of these problems that in a greater or lesser extent we all have created, since 2006 a group of Mexican Professionals gave themselves the task of developing new techniques and strategies to rethink the final disposal of waste from some diverse human activities in our country, in particular Solid and Liquid Organic Waste, both urban and agro-industrial, so that, additional to disposing of them in an ecological and sustainable way, energy and other useful and environmentally friendly products can be obtained from
such waste.
This group, currently constituted as a Non-Governmental Organization, is called: ASOCIACIÓN MEXICANA DE BIOMASA Y BIOGAS*, A.C. (also known as AMBB®).
